JetX Game Bangladesh – How to Play, RTP, Demo, and Mobile Access
JetX is one of the leading crash games in online gambling and one of the strongest alternatives to classic multiplier titles. Built by SmartSoft, the game combines a simple core mechanic with a deeper feature set that includes auto cash out, two independent bets per round, real-time statistics, moderated chat, and multiplatform support. For users in Bangladesh, JetX is especially attractive because it works well in short mobile sessions and does not require knowledge of paylines, reels, or complex bonus rules.
The game starts with a rising multiplier and ends when the jet explodes. If you cash out before the explosion, the payout equals your stake multiplied by the value at exit. If the jet explodes first, the bet is lost. That basic mechanic is easy to understand, but the real value of JetX is in its extra depth: two bets per round, manual or automatic exits, and a published RTP range that is broader than many users expect.

What Is JetX?
JetX is a crash game based on a rising multiplier that can end at any time. The player’s goal is to secure profit before the explosion. What makes the title different from many similar games is the way it blends timing with optional automation. You can run manual exits, set auto cash-out points in advance, or split risk by using two different stakes in the same round.
According to SmartSoft, JetX helped redefine the non-traditional casino-game category after launching in 2018. The official game page also describes it as one of the provider’s flagship products and highlights its international scale through support for over 100 currencies and more than 30 languages.

JetX RTP, Mechanics, and Risk Structure
JetX publishes a relatively broad RTP range: 96.2% to 98.9%. That does not mean every session sits somewhere inside that corridor in a smooth way. In a crash game, short-term outcomes are still highly volatile because the payout depends on whether the player exits before the round ends.
What matters more in practice is the structure of the game. SmartSoft explicitly states that the multiplier is RNG-based. It also states that the explosion may happen as early as 1.00x. That is the single most important rule to remember, because it proves there is no floor that guarantees a safe exit.
| Mechanic | Meaning in Practice |
|---|---|
| RTP 96.2%–98.9% | A strong theoretical range, but still compatible with sharp short-term swings. |
| RNG-based multiplier | The height of the round is generated randomly. |
| Explosion at 1.00x | A round can end instantly, so there is no guaranteed early profit. |
| Two bets per round | You can split risk inside one session round. |
| Auto cash out | Useful for discipline if you want to avoid emotional hesitation. |
| Payout formula | Multiplier × Bet |
Why Two Bets per Round Matter
This is one of the biggest practical differences between JetX and many simpler crash formats. Because the game allows two independent bets per round, you can use two different ideas at once. For example, one bet can cash out early at a lower multiplier while the second one chases a higher target. That does not reduce randomness, but it changes how risk is distributed.
Used well, this mechanic can make the game feel more structured. Used badly, it can make losses scale faster because the player is effectively doubling exposure. That is why JetX is simple on the surface but more tactical than it first appears.

JetX Demo vs Real Money
JetX demo mode is the best way to understand the real difference between manual cash out and auto cash out. In demo mode, you can also test whether two-bet structuring actually helps your style or simply increases risk without improving discipline.
Real-money mode should only begin after you understand one thing clearly: two bets per round do not make the game safer by default. They only make it more flexible. Bankroll management is still the key variable.

What Is Aviator and Why Is It So Popular?
Aviator belongs to the crash-game category. In each round, a multiplier grows upward and can stop at any moment. If the player cashes out before the round crashes, the payout is calculated as the multiplier multiplied by the stake. If the round ends before cash out, the bet is lost. This is the whole core mechanic, and that simplicity is exactly why the game scales so well on mobile devices.
The game also stands out because it is not isolated in the same way as a regular slot. Official Aviator product descriptions emphasize that the title is engaging and social, with players able to see bets, wins, and community activity in real time. That creates a different atmosphere from standard solo casino gameplay.

Aviator RTP, Volatility, and Core Mechanics
The official RTP of Aviator is 97%. In simple terms, RTP means the long-run mathematical return built into the game. It does not guarantee that a player will receive 97% back in one session, one day, or even one week. In a crash game, short-term outcomes can vary heavily because results depend on exactly when the player cashes out and how the random multiplier sequence unfolds.
This is why Aviator should be viewed as a high-variance timing game. The RTP tells you about the mathematical model, but the actual session result depends on your cash-out discipline. A player who always waits for extreme multipliers will usually face higher volatility than a player who uses smaller and earlier exits.
| Mechanic | What It Means for the Player |
|---|---|
| 97% RTP | Strong long-run return figure for a crash game, but not a short-session guarantee. |
| Random crash point | The round can stop at any moment, so there is no “safe” multiplier. |
| Manual cash out | You decide when to secure profit. |
| Fast round speed | More action in less time, but also more emotional risk if you overplay. |
| Social visibility | Other users’ visible bets and wins can affect your own decisions if you follow them emotionally. |
Aviator 2.0 and Mobile Performance
Aviator’s mobile strength is not accidental. Official product and update notes describe the game as a light build created for budget devices and low-bandwidth conditions. The 2.0 update made the game 40% faster, more lightweight, and introduced a redesigned mobile version that duplicates the desktop experience more closely.
That matters for Bangladesh traffic because a crash game only works well if it stays responsive under average mobile-network conditions. Slow or unstable performance can directly affect the user experience in timing-based games. Aviator was clearly optimized for this problem from early on.

Aviator Demo vs Real Money
Demo mode is the smartest starting point for new users. The rules are the same, but virtual balance is used instead of real money. That allows players to learn the speed of rounds, test early cash-out habits, and see how quickly emotional decisions can affect the result.
Real-money mode should only be used after the basic flow feels comfortable. Aviator looks simple, but fast games often create more impulsive decisions than classic casino titles. A short demo session is enough to prevent many bad first-day mistakes.

Aviator Strategy: Practical Rules That Matter More Than Myths
There is no guaranteed winning formula in Aviator. The crash point is random, which means no signal, chat trend, or visual pattern can eliminate uncertainty. Still, some practical rules make more sense than others:
- Use a fixed session budget before the first round.
- Decide your target cash-out range before the round starts.
- Do not increase stake size only because you missed the previous multiplier.
- Leave the session after a planned profit or a planned loss limit.
- Ignore social pressure from visible high multipliers won by other players.
